HOW HOT IS THE ROOM?

Classes marked warm or hot take place in a heated room. Warm classes offer gentler heat; Hot classes are more intense. Hydrate before class, listen to your body and step out or rest whenever needed. If heat is not right for you, choose one of our non-heated offerings.

Warm‍ ‍80–85°F

Hot‍ ‍90–100°F

HEALTH, INJURIES & PREGNANCY

Tell your teacher before class about injuries, pregnancy or anything that may affect your movement or comfort in heat. When appropriate, consult your healthcare professional before beginning a new movement practice.
